| Connect the free ends of the dynamometer springs and stretch them. Record the dynamometer readings and explain the result of the experiment.
F1 = 10 H,
F2 = 10 H
The force of action is equal to the force of counteraction modulo
Conclusion: The force of action is equal in magnitude to the force of reaction
